Spirogyra are a British folk/prog band that recorded three albums between 1971 and 1973. With occasional use of unusual rhythms, intriguing blends of styles, innovative arrangements, and lyrics to ponder, St. Radigunds had it all, and quickly established Spirogyra as one of the most creative and innovative groups of the day.

Released on Strange Days Records under British Rock Masterpiece series, part 1.
Originally released on B&C / CAS1042.
Personnel:
Martin Cockerham - singer/guitarist/songwriter
Barbara Gaskin - singer
Julian Cusack - violinist/keyboardist
Steve Borrill - bassist
Dave Mattacks - drums
